100 Words Essay on My Pet

Introduction

I have a pet dog named Bruno. He is not just an animal but a part of my family. His presence brings joy and happiness in our lives.

Appearance

Bruno is a Labrador, with a shiny golden coat. He has big, bright eyes that are full of life and a tail that wags in delight every time he sees us.

Qualities

Bruno is very intelligent and obedient. He understands our commands and follows them diligently. He is also very playful and loves to play with balls.

Conclusion

Having Bruno as my pet has taught me responsibility and unconditional love. He is truly my best friend.

250 Words Essay on My Pet

Introduction: A Companion Like No Other

Pets are more than just animals; they are family members, confidants, and sources of unconditional love. My pet, a Golden Retriever named Max, is no exception. He has been an integral part of my life, teaching me invaluable lessons about compassion, responsibility, and the joy of simple companionship.

The Bond: Unspoken Yet Profound

Max and I share a bond that transcends the barrier of speech. His expressive eyes and wagging tail communicate more than words ever could. Our bond is not just about companionship; it is also about mutual respect and understanding. Max’s sensitivity to human emotions is remarkable. He has an uncanny ability to sense my moods and respond accordingly, providing comfort during difficult times and sharing in my joy during moments of triumph.

Lessons from Max: Unconditional Love and Responsibility

Max has taught me the true meaning of unconditional love. His unwavering affection, regardless of my mood or the circumstances, is a constant reminder of this pure form of love. Additionally, having Max has instilled a sense of responsibility in me. His wellbeing depends on my actions, from ensuring his regular exercise to providing a balanced diet. This responsibility has matured me as an individual, teaching me to prioritize and manage my time effectively.

Conclusion: Pets, A Source of Joy and Growth

In conclusion, my pet Max has not only been a source of joy but also a catalyst for personal growth. The lessons of love, compassion, and responsibility that he has taught me are invaluable. I believe that having a pet enriches one’s life in ways that are profound and lasting. Indeed, pets are not just animals; they are companions, teachers, and family.

500 Words Essay on My Pet

Introduction

Pets are more than just animals living in our homes; they are our companions, confidants, and often considered as part of the family. They bring joy, comfort, and teach us about empathy, responsibility, and unconditional love. In this essay, I will share my personal experience with my pet, a golden retriever named Max, and explore the profound impact he has had on my life.

Choosing Max

The process of choosing Max was a deliberate one. We researched different breeds, considering their temperament, potential health issues, and compatibility with our lifestyle. We decided on a golden retriever because of their friendly nature and resilience. Max was just a few weeks old when we brought him home, a bundle of joy and energy that instantly brought life to our house.

Life with Max

Max, with his playful demeanor and boundless energy, quickly became an integral part of our family. His enthusiasm is infectious, his loyalty is unwavering, and his capacity for love is limitless. Max has taught me the importance of living in the moment. He doesn’t dwell on the past or worry about the future; he simply enjoys the present. This is a lesson that has had a profound impact on my outlook on life.

Responsibility and Empathy

Having Max in our lives has also instilled a deep sense of responsibility. Pets rely on their owners for everything, from feeding to grooming to medical care. This responsibility has taught me to prioritize and manage my time effectively. Moreover, understanding Max’s needs and emotions has nurtured my empathy. His expressive eyes and body language speak volumes about his feelings, and interpreting these signals has helped me to develop a deeper understanding of non-verbal communication.

Max’s Influence on My Mental Health

Research suggests that pets can have a positive impact on mental health, and my experience with Max supports this. During stressful periods, Max’s company has been a source of comfort and relaxation. His mere presence, his soft fur under my fingers, and his unconditional affection all contribute to a sense of calm and well-being. Max has been my constant companion, providing emotional support and companionship that has been instrumental in maintaining my mental health.

Conclusion

In conclusion, Max, my golden retriever, has had a significant influence on my life. He has taught me valuable lessons about responsibility, empathy, and the importance of living in the moment. He has also been a source of comfort and emotional support during challenging times. Pets, like Max, offer us more than just companionship; they provide us with life lessons, emotional support, and a unique bond that enriches our lives.
